Why Group Energy Accelerates Change
1. Breaking the Silence of Imposter Syndrome
Nothing dissolves imposter syndrome faster than hearing a high-achieving C-suite executive or a successful consultant admit they also feel like a fraud sometimes. In a group setting, the shame of self-doubt loses its power. When we speak our fears out loud to a supportive circle, they stop being heavy anchors and start being manageable data points.
2. The Power of "Vicarious Learning"
In group coaching, you aren't just learning from your own breakthroughs. You are learning from every question asked and every hurdle overcome by your peers. Often, a fellow member will voice a challenge you didn't even know you had: or provide a perspective that completely shifts your mindset coaching journey. It’s a multiplier effect for your personal growth.
3. Built-in Accountability and Momentum
Let’s be honest, my loves: it’s easy to cancel a meeting with yourself. It’s much harder to hide when you have a tribe of women cheering you on. The collective energy creates a gentle, supportive pressure that keeps you moving toward your Confidence-Led Growth Strategy. You aren't just doing it for you; you're doing it with them.
